Register for the 2024 Annual General Business Meeting (AGM) -
Thursday, October 24, 2024
In accordance with By-law 13.4(a), all professional
members and interns are invited to the 2024 Annual General Meeting of the
Association. Interns, professional members, and councillors are entitled to be
present; any other person may be admitted by invitation of the President or
with the consent of those present who are entitled to vote, as per By-law
13.5. For this year, assessment candidates, licensees, and students are also
invited by the President to observe the AGM. Registration is required to
attend this event. To attend and for more information, please see our
event listing.
Government Relations Advisory Committee (GRAC) -
Multiple Positions
GRAC assists and advises the Director of Government Relations on provincial government and rural and urban municipality community relations,
lobbying activities, and on operational planning for the Department. The primary focus of GRAC for the next several years will be to assist the
Government Relations Department in a major rewrite of the Association's legislation, The Engineering and Geoscientific Professions Act.
The committee is looking for members; professional geoscientists (P.Geo.), engineers (P.Eng.) or interns in good standing with the Association,
from various disciplines, who are committed to developing a good relationship with government while supporting the philosophy, strategy, and actions
of the Association. Membership of this committee is comprised of individuals who are willing and able to act as non-partisan individuals
when representing the Association as part of this Committee. For full details, please review the full
call for volunteers.
